Exactly How Noise Affects the Sleeping Brain

 


The human mind stays energetic throughout rest, refining details even while at rest. This is why certain noises, like a banging door or honking horn, can shake us awake. Nonetheless, not all sound interferes with rest. In fact, predictable and calming sounds can help reduce the brain's sensitivity to disturbances, creating a steady acoustic environment that shields the sleeper from sudden changes in their acoustic environments.

 


Consider ambient sound as a covering for your ears. It assists mask the disconcerting disruptions of city life, family motion, or unpredictable outdoor sounds. By keeping a regular audio backdrop, the mind is much less likely to react to sudden noises, allowing rest to grow and stay continuous.

 


The Science Behind Soundscapes

 


Soundscapes differ from arbitrary noise because they are typically curated or picked for their calming high qualities. These sounds correspond, low in quantity, and commonly imitate natural surroundings. Waves rolling gently onto a coastline, rains on a rooftop, rustling leaves, or soft instrumental songs can all be examples of efficient ambient soundscapes.

 


These calming sound patterns activate the parasympathetic nerve system, which helps the body loosen up. Breathing slows, muscular tissues release tension, and the mind changes into a state that's even more receptive to sleep. For those that fight with overthinking or auto racing thoughts at bedtime, ambient sound can offer just sufficient excitement to quiet the interior babble without keeping the brain excessively sharp.

 


Finding the Right Sound for You

 


Everybody reacts differently to seem. What relaxes one person may aggravate an additional. Some people find nature seems particularly reliable, while others favor the soft whirl of a fan or the stable buzz of white noise. Pink noise, which is a mix of frequencies that simulate all-natural seem like wind or rainfall, has actually additionally obtained appeal for its relaxing buildings.

 


The trick is to experiment and pay attention to how your body and mind respond. If a sound helps you drop off to sleep quicker or allows you to stay asleep longer, you've most likely located a valuable device for your sleep routine. Simply make certain the quantity stays low and consistent. Loud or changing sounds can do even more damage than great.

 


Rest Disorders and Sound Therapy

 


For people handling particular sleep obstacles, soundscapes can be a useful complement to therapy. Problems like sleep wake disorder frequently make it difficult to develop a regular sleep routine. Ambient sound, when made use of on a regular basis, can assist the body associate specific sounds with remainder, strengthening a pattern of sleeping at the same time each night.

 


Individuals with sleep problems might locate soundscapes useful in breaking cycles of anxiety connected with bedtime. When existing awake becomes a source of stress and anxiety, the comforting background of ambient noise can reduce tension and provide a mild course into rest. It won't address every underlying problem, yet it can provide a significant improvement in general sleep quality.
